Output 6af29db54e4c77da2106bcee5218cd8b94434113511ad0f3e0956f2ab483ade7:6

value
45862650
script pubkey
OP_0 OP_PUSHBYTES_20 051203ad2d95bae6ce2ea5c23cba61d46930ad73
address
ltc1qq5fq8tfdjkawdn3w5hprewnp635npttnuu32k4
transaction
6af29db54e4c77da2106bcee5218cd8b94434113511ad0f3e0956f2ab483ade7
spent
true